Central National Gottesman's Kelly Spicers acquires Los Angeles-based distributor Keldon Paper, which is focused on paper for commercial printers

Sample article from our Pulp & Paper Industry

March 8, 2022 (press release) –

We are pleased to announce that Kelly Spicers has acquired Los Angeles-based Keldon Paper Company, a true legacy paper company that has served the Southern California market for nearly 70 years.

We are particularly pleased with the addition of Keldon Paper because it represents a further commitment to our core business: Paper. As a family run, independent company whose product expertise and reputation for customer service is legendary, Keldon is focused on paper and the commercial printer.

We anticipate a wider range of product options, which we know is especially important in today’s environment. Additionally, our own enhanced customer service, warehouse technology and logistics capabilities mean doing business with Kelly Spicers will continue to be easy for all our customers.

We are confident this addition will only strengthen our industry for the future.
